Output d24caa19d6b994dc3c1126b759d642bc3e4414f13c02f32fdce06425412b54c1:12

value
15963857
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53a60169f6659efbf095ece7ff148dfe82f20978 OP_EQUAL
address
MFXTBcoS6BzaHEskuvH8GULJugqY7QLmcA
transaction
d24caa19d6b994dc3c1126b759d642bc3e4414f13c02f32fdce06425412b54c1
spent
true